 1.2 Statement of the Problem

The problem of labour revenue attracts a reasonable percentage of attention in an organization because labour represents the life wire of any organization. The rate at which employee have organization is alarming, the type and number of works who are terminated or resigning their various jobs show how effective and efficient is the management in its operation which also determined the level of stability, growth and development of the organization. Although, in some organizations, there is extent to which mobility of workers is considered acceptable.

 1.3 Objective of the Study

The primary objective of this study is to examine the effort of labour revenue on the performance of an organization with reference to the Akwa Ibom State water corporation Based on the primary objective, the study aim to

  1. Find out the relationship between labour revenue and the performance of an organization.
  2. Find out the effect of labour revenue on the performances of an organization.
  3. Assess the extent of labour revenue in the production of goods and services of an organization.
  4. Find out variable that could help to combat against labour revenue of an organization.

 1.4 Research Questions

The research questions formulated were;

  1. What is the relationship between labour revenue and the performance of an organization?
  2. What is the effect of labour revenue on the performance of an organization?
  3. How the extent of labour revenue in the production of goods and services of an organization could be assessed?
  4. What are the variables that could help to combat labour revenue of an organization?

 

1.5 Research Hypothesis

The research hypotheses were formulated using null statements.

Ho: There is no significant relationship between labour revenue and the performances of an organization.

Ho: There is no significant effect of labour revenue on the performance of an organization.
